Welcome to Barbecast 66! After last episode's 1,000 pitch festivities, we've returned this week with a fairly regular Barbecast -- at least, as regular as Barbecasts go. Our special guest this week (at 15:47) is Luke Ramirez, one of the most notorious players in Little League World Series history and a huge part of the 2009 LLWS Champion Chula Vista team. We talked to Luke about all the ridiculousness surrounding the Little League World Series, including:
How his team survived the California regionals and made it to Williamsport
Game-by-game analysis of the team's championship run
Hitting all the dingers
Being one of the biggest kids in the tournament
Having a Yahoo Answers question about how he was a ringer
The absurdities of being in Williamsport
That awkward moment when they won the championship
...and more!
After we talked to Luke (at 59:05), we participated in yet another B-Ref Battle of extraordinary baseball names. After B-Ref (at 1:18:08), Tales from Logdog with Lana Berry covered Lana's #FinalVote candidacy and why she doesn't even really wanna get voted into the All-Star Game. We conclude with a brief discussion on our recent trip to North Carolina and look ahead to the rest of the summer. Thanks for listening <3
